How to cook Easy Oven Baked Beans: Soul-Food 101
Baked Beans
Ingredients:
1 1/2 Lb. ground beef
3/4 cup chopped onions
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on black pepper
3 tablespoons vinegar
3 tablespoons sugar
1 large or 2 16 oz can pork and beans
3/4 cup ketchup
1/2 Tabasco sauce
Directions:
Cook beef and onions in Skillet. Drain. Add remaining ingredients and mix well. Put into casserole dish and bake at 350 degrees for 30 minutes.
